use carrot creme and indian hemp
I usually wash my hair a couple times a week now, when I first started trying to get waves on it did it more frequent. I would use an old brush tobrush my hair when washing it too....carrot creme and indian hemp is a good combo..there are plenty of other products that work too though...you just need agood brush, keep your hair moisturized/conditioned ( no need to over saturate ) and wrapped up at night.

continue that process and brush as much as possible. you'll be spinning in no time
 
Wolfing is basically when you grow out your hair while you train it to lay down (brushing)
I usually wolf every 3 months to make my waves deeper..and brushing when you wash your hair like homie said above is a plus
